Understanding The Process Of Being Served A Section 21 Notice

If you’re a tenant renting a property in the UK, the term “served a section 21 notice” may sound intimidating and confusing. In simple terms, being served a section 21 notice means that your landlord is seeking to regain possession of the property without giving a specific reason. This legal process allows landlords to evict tenants after their fixed-term tenancy agreement has ended or during a periodic tenancy.

So, what exactly does it mean to be served a section 21 notice, and what steps should you take if you find yourself in this situation? This article will provide you with a comprehensive overview of the process and your rights as a tenant.

First and foremost, it’s important to understand the purpose of a section 21 notice. Landlords typically use this notice as a straightforward way to evict tenants without needing to prove any fault on the tenant’s part. However, there are strict legal requirements that landlords must follow when serving a section 21 notice.

One of the key requirements is that the landlord must provide the tenant with at least two months’ notice before seeking possession of the property through the courts. This notice must be served in writing and include specific details such as the date by which the tenant is expected to vacate the property.

If the tenant fails to leave the property by the specified date, the landlord can apply to the court for a possession order. It’s worth noting that a possession order obtained through a section 21 notice is typically easier to obtain than other types of possession orders, as the landlord does not need to prove any wrongdoing on the tenant’s part.

As a tenant who has been served a section 21 notice, it’s important to be aware of your rights and options. Firstly, you should check that the landlord has followed all the necessary legal requirements when serving the notice. For example, the landlord must have protected your deposit in a government-approved deposit protection scheme and provided you with certain documents at the start of the tenancy.

If you believe that the landlord has not followed the correct procedures, you may be able to challenge the section 21 notice in court. This could delay the eviction process and give you more time to find alternative accommodation.

Alternatively, if you have been a model tenant and paid your rent on time, you may be able to negotiate with the landlord to extend the notice period or reach a mutual agreement to terminate the tenancy early. It’s always worth exploring all possible options before taking any drastic action.

If you decide to challenge the section 21 notice in court, it’s advisable to seek legal advice from a solicitor who specializes in landlord and tenant law. They can help you understand your rights, gather evidence to support your case, and represent you in court if necessary.

Understanding Legionnaires Temperature: How Temperature Impacts Legionella Bacteria Growth

Legionnaires’ disease is a severe form of pneumonia caused by the Legionella bacteria This potentially fatal illness can be contracted by inhaling contaminated water droplets or mist that contains the bacteria Legionella thrives in warm, stagnant water, making certain environments more conducive to its growth One critical factor that plays a significant role in the proliferation of Legionella bacteria is temperature.

Temperature is a crucial variable in the growth and survival of Legionella bacteria The ideal temperature range for Legionella to thrive is between 77-108 degrees Fahrenheit (25-42 degrees Celsius) At temperatures below 68 degrees Fahrenheit (20 degrees Celsius), Legionella bacteria can survive, but they do not multiply In contrast, temperatures above 122 degrees Fahrenheit (50 degrees Celsius) will kill Legionella bacteria Understanding the impact of temperature on Legionella growth is essential for preventing the spread of Legionnaires’ disease.

Warmer temperatures are considered favorable for Legionella growth, as they provide an optimal environment for the bacteria to multiply In tropical and subtropical climates, where temperatures are consistently warm, the risk of Legionella contamination is higher Water systems in buildings such as hotels, hospitals, and office buildings are particularly vulnerable to Legionella growth if the water temperature is not properly regulated.

Stagnant water is another critical factor that contributes to the growth of Legionella bacteria Water that sits undisturbed for long periods provides an ideal breeding ground for bacteria This is why it is essential to ensure that water systems are properly maintained, flushed regularly, and kept at the correct temperature to prevent Legionella contamination.

The risk of Legionella contamination is highest in water systems that are poorly maintained or neglected legionnaires temperature. If water systems are not flushed regularly or if water temperatures are not monitored, Legionella bacteria can quickly multiply and pose a significant health risk to building occupants Regular maintenance of water systems, including cleaning and disinfection, is crucial for preventing Legionella contamination.

In recent years, there has been a growing awareness of the importance of monitoring water temperatures to prevent Legionella contamination Many countries have introduced regulations and guidelines to ensure that water systems are properly maintained and that Legionella risks are minimized Building owners and managers are now required to conduct regular testing of water systems, including monitoring water temperatures, to prevent the spread of Legionella bacteria.

One effective method for controlling Legionella growth is by maintaining water temperatures outside the bacteria’s ideal range By keeping water temperatures below 68 degrees Fahrenheit (20 degrees Celsius) or above 122 degrees Fahrenheit (50 degrees Celsius), the growth of Legionella bacteria can be inhibited Regularly flushing water systems can also help prevent stagnation and reduce the risk of Legionella contamination.

The Importance Of Conventional Fire Alarms

When it comes to protecting lives and property, fire alarms are an essential tool. conventional fire alarms have been a staple in fire protection for many years, providing reliable and cost-effective solutions for a variety of buildings and facilities. In this article, we will explore the importance of conventional fire alarms and how they play a crucial role in keeping people safe.

conventional fire alarms are a type of fire detection system that is often used in smaller buildings or facilities. They consist of a central control panel that is connected to a series of manual call points, smoke detectors, and sounder devices. When a fire is detected, the system will activate the sounders to alert occupants of the building and notify the authorities.

One of the main advantages of conventional fire alarms is their affordability. Compared to more advanced systems like addressable fire alarms, conventional fire alarms are much more cost-effective, making them a popular choice for budget-conscious building owners. Despite their lower cost, conventional fire alarms are still highly effective at alerting occupants of a fire emergency and helping to minimize the risk of injuries or deaths.

In addition to their affordability, conventional fire alarms are also easy to install and maintain. The system typically consists of simple components that can be easily integrated into existing buildings without the need for extensive rewiring or construction work. This makes conventional fire alarms a practical choice for buildings that do not have the budget or infrastructure for more complex fire detection systems.

Another key benefit of conventional fire alarms is their reliability. These systems have been used for decades and have a proven track record of effectively detecting fires and alerting occupants in a timely manner. The central control panel is designed to continuously monitor the connected devices to ensure they are functioning properly, providing peace of mind to building owners and occupants alike.

conventional fire alarms are also highly customizable to meet the specific needs of different buildings and facilities. Building owners can choose from a variety of smoke detectors, heat detectors, and sounder devices to create a system that is tailored to the unique layout and requirements of their property. This flexibility allows for greater coverage and sensitivity to potential fire hazards, ultimately leading to better protection for occupants and property.

Despite their many benefits, conventional fire alarms are not without limitations. One of the main drawbacks of these systems is their limited ability to pinpoint the exact location of a fire. Unlike addressable fire alarms that can identify the specific device that has been activated, conventional fire alarms only provide a general indication of the area where the fire has been detected. This can make it more challenging for firefighters to quickly locate and extinguish the fire, potentially leading to greater damage and loss.

To overcome this limitation, building owners can supplement their conventional fire alarms with additional detection devices such as flame detectors or thermal imaging cameras. These technologies can provide greater insight into the location and severity of a fire, allowing for a more targeted and effective response by emergency personnel. By combining different fire detection technologies, building owners can enhance the overall safety and security of their property.

Understanding Compensation For Unfair Dismissal

Unfair dismissal is a situation where an employer terminates an employee’s contract of employment in a way that breaches one or more of the statutory protections This could be due to discrimination, whistleblowing, or asserting a legal right When an employee is dismissed unfairly, they have the right to seek compensation for the financial loss and distress caused by the dismissal.

Compensation for unfair dismissal can vary depending on the circumstances of the case and the decision of the Employment Tribunal In some cases, the compensation awarded may be in the form of reinstatement, where the employee is given their job back, or re-engagement, where the employee is given a different job within the same organization However, in most cases, compensation is awarded in the form of a monetary sum.

The calculation of compensation for unfair dismissal can be complex and involves several factors One of the key factors taken into consideration is the length of service of the employee The longer an employee has been employed by the company, the higher the compensation is likely to be This is because employees with longer service are likely to have deeper roots within the company and may find it more difficult to secure alternative employment.

Another important factor in determining compensation for unfair dismissal is the employee’s age Older employees may find it more challenging to secure new employment, and as a result, they may be awarded higher compensation Additionally, the impact of the dismissal on the employee’s future career prospects may also be taken into account when calculating compensation.

Financial loss is another crucial aspect considered when determining compensation for unfair dismissal This may include the loss of earnings, benefits, or any other financial implications arising from the dismissal The tribunal will assess the actual financial loss suffered by the employee and award compensation accordingly.

In addition to financial loss, compensation for unfair dismissal may also include an element for injury to feelings compensation unfair dismissal. If an employee has suffered distress, humiliation, or loss of dignity as a result of the dismissal, they may be awarded compensation to reflect this In cases where the dismissal was particularly harsh or traumatic, the tribunal may award a higher amount of compensation for injury to feelings.

It is important to note that there are limits on the amount of compensation that can be awarded for unfair dismissal The maximum compensatory award for unfair dismissal is currently capped at £88,519 or one year’s gross salary, whichever is lower This means that even if an employee can prove that they have suffered significant financial loss and distress as a result of unfair dismissal, the tribunal may still be limited in the amount of compensation they can award.

In cases where the dismissal was due to discrimination, the compensation awarded can be unlimited This is to reflect the seriousness of discrimination in the workplace and the impact it can have on individuals Discrimination can take many forms, such as age, race, gender, or disability discrimination, and the tribunal will take this into account when determining compensation.
